Home Depot
25 mile radius of Wallingford, CT
5/16/2025
Southington, CT, US
5/15/2025
Hamden, CT, US
Hamden, CT, US
Hamden, CT, US
Hamden, CT, US
Hamden, CT, US
Orange, CT, US
5/14/2025
Hamden, CT, US
North Haven, CT, US
5/7/2025
Glastonbury, CT, US